Electric Connection, C-10 Electrical Contractor in Orangevale, CA
Electric Connection operating as a corporation holds an active California contractor license (CSLB #794286), valid through Apr 30, 2027. First issued in 2001, the license has been on the CSLB roster for 25 years. It carries a single CSLB classification: C-10 — Electrical Contractor. Records show an active surety bond on file with American Contractors Indemnity Company and active workers' compensation coverage from Hartford Casualty Insurance Company. The business is based in Orangevale, in Sacramento County, California.
